带着这个问题到网上搜索,大多数文章在解释这个问题的时候,上来就是@SpringBootApplication注解中找@EnableAutoConfiguration注解,然后找到@Import(AutoConfigurationImportSelector.class)注解,然后就到AutoConfigurationImportSelector类中找,惊呆?~不过也没错,最后确实是因为这个注解这个
转载 2023-11-11 10:24:18
50阅读
一、ActiveMQ简介1). ActiveMQActiveMQ是Apache所提供的一个开源的消息系统,完全采用Java来实现,因此,它能很好地支持J2EE提出的JMS(Java Message Service,即Java消息服务)规范。JMS是一组Java应用程序接口,它提供消息的创建、发送、读取等一系列服务。JMS提供了一组公共应用程序接口和响应的语法,类似于Java数据库的统一访问接口JD
1、生产pom.xml<dependencies> <dependency> <groupId>com.rabbitmq</groupId> <artifactId>amqp-client</artifactId> <version
转载 8月前
78阅读
# Spring Boot 和 RabbitMQ 的多个消费者示例 在现代微服务架构中,异步消息处理成为了系统解耦和提高性能的重要手段。RabbitMQ 是一个流行的消息中间,而 Spring Boot 则通过其简便的配置和集成能力使得与 RabbitMQ 的交互变得更加简单。在本篇文章中,我们将探讨如何在 Spring Boot 中实现多个消费者,并通过代码示例加以说明。 ## Rabbi
原创 8月前
142阅读
# Spring Boot RabbitMQ Listener与多个消费者 RabbitMQ 是一个流行的消息队列系统,以其高效的消息传递能力和灵活的路由机制在微服务架构中扮演了重要角色。Spring Boot 提供了方便的集成,使得开发能够轻松地创建消息消费者。本文将探讨如何使用 Spring Boot 创建多个 RabbitMQ 消费者,以及它们之间的高效协作。 ## RabbitMQ
原创 2024-10-27 05:37:44
241阅读
# Spring Boot Kafka 多个消费者与单播模式的探索 Apache Kafka 是一个分布式流媒体平台,广泛用于构建实时数据管道和流应用。借助 Kafka 的强大功能,Spring Boot 可以简化 Kafka 的使用,使开发能够快速构建和管理消息驱动的应用。在这篇文章中,我们将探讨如何在 Spring Boot 中实现多个消费者的单播模式。 ## 一、概念解析 ### 1
原创 2024-10-13 03:13:38
201阅读
# Spring Boot MQ 创建多个消费者 随着微服务架构的发展,消息队列(MQ)的重要性愈发突出。通过消息队列,各个服务之间可以实现解耦、异步处理等功能。在Spring Boot中,Kafka和RabbitMQ是最常用的消息队列。本文将重点介绍如何在Spring Boot项目中创建多个消费者,以便更灵活地处理消息。 ## 1. 什么是消费者消费者是从消息队列中读取消息的组件。在消
原创 9月前
61阅读
### Spring Boot 和 RabbitMQ 的多个消费者轮询机制 在现代微服务架构中,消息队列作为服务之间通信的解耦方案被广泛应用。RabbitMQ 是一种流行的开源消息代理,支持多种消息模式。本文将探讨如何使用 Spring Boot 和 RabbitMQ 实现多个消费者的轮询机制,并通过示例代码和图示来展示其工作原理。 #### 1. 背景知识 RabbitMQ 允许我们在多个
原创 9月前
235阅读
前一篇中我们介绍了使用RabbitMQ ​​Java​​ Client访问RabbitMQ的方法。但是使用这种方式访问RabbitMQ,开发在程序中需要自己管理Connection,Channel对象,Consumer对象的创建,销毁,这样会非常不方便。我们下面介绍使用​​spring​​ AMQP连接RabbitMQ,进行消息的接收和发送。Spring AMQP是一个Spring子项目,它提供
转载 2014-01-14 10:09:00
184阅读
## Spring Boot 和 RabbitMQ:实现多个消费者不重复消费 在现代分布式系统中,消息队列扮演着重要的角色。RabbitMQ 是一种流行的开源消息代理,常与 Spring Boot 一起使用,来构建可靠和易伸缩的微服务架构。在本文中,我们将探讨如何使用 RabbitMQ 实现多个消费者的不重复消费,并通过代码示例来加深理解。 ### 一、RabbitMQ 的基本概念 Rabb
原创 9月前
333阅读
及时获取有趣有料消费模式消息消费有两种模式: 1、并发消费并发消费是默认的处理方法,一个消费者使用线程池技术,可以并发消费多条消息,提升机器的资源利用率。默认配置是 20 个线程,所以一台机器默认情况下,同一瞬间可以消费 20 个消息。关注公众后码猿技术专栏获取更多面试资源。其中 ConsumeMessageConcurrentlyService 的构造函数如下:public ConsumeMe
转载 2024-05-14 22:20:07
332阅读
上一篇文章:RabbitMQ 基本消息模型和消息确认机制 - 无名的小猪的文章 - 知乎 https://zhuanlan.zhihu.com/p/114550734 详细讲述了 RabbitMQ 的基本消息模型的搭建和 RabbitMQ 的消息确认机制,这一篇文章将带大家动手实现 RabbitMQ 实现公平派遣(分发)任务。先来看一下 RabbitMQ 工作队列和竞争消费者简化模型:
简单模式 生产,一个队列一个或多个消费者,当多个消费者同时监听一个队列时,他们并不能同时消费一条消息,而是随机消费消息,即一个队列中一条消息,只能被一个消费者消费。订阅与发布模式(fanout) 生产,一个交换机(fanoutExchange),没有路由规则,多个队列,多个消费者。生产将消息不是直接发送到队列,而是发送到X交换机,然后由交换机发送给两个队列,两个消费者各自监听一个队列,来消费
转载 2024-03-28 10:03:58
197阅读
模拟发布订阅模式,一个消息发给多个消费者。实现一个发送日志,一个接收将接收到的数据写到硬盘上,与此同时,另一个接收把接收到的消息展现在屏幕上。转发器类型使用:fanout。fanout类型转发器特别简单,把所有它介绍到的消息,广播到所有它所知道的队列。直接上代码了:首先配置好ribbitpackage com.cnjy.ecampus.ribbitmq; import java.io.IOEx
转载 2024-01-01 13:26:54
238阅读
上一次我们聊了RabbitMQ服务的构建和简单使用。我在这里聊一下里面的关键字:Message :消息,消息是不具名的,它由消息头和消息体组成。消息体是不透明的,而消息头则由一系列的可选属性组成,这些属性包括routing-key(路由键)、 priority(相对于其他消息的优先权)、 delivery-mode(指出 该消息可能需要持久性存储)等。Publisher:消息的生产,也
转载 2024-04-01 14:14:13
123阅读
# Spring Boot Kafka 消费者 Kafka 是一个分布式流处理平台,广泛用于实时数据流处理。Spring Boot 与 Kafka 的结合使得开发可以轻松地构建高性能、可扩展的流处理应用程序。本文将介绍如何在 Spring Boot 应用程序中实现 Kafka 消费者。 ## Kafka 消费者简介 Kafka 消费者是一个从 Kafka 主题中读取数据的组件。消费者可以订
原创 2024-07-18 14:06:45
134阅读
# Spring Boot RocketMQ消费者实现指南 ## 引言 在本文中,我们将指导一位刚入行的小白如何实现Spring Boot RocketMQ消费者。我们将逐步介绍整个实现流程,并提供相应的代码示例和注释。在阅读本文之前,假设你已经对Spring Boot和RocketMQ有基本的了解。 ## 实现流程 下面是实现Spring Boot RocketMQ消费者的整个流程: |
原创 2023-10-17 15:31:34
332阅读
(一)、什么是AMQPAMQP与rabbitmq的关系    说简单点就是在异步通讯中,消息不会立刻到达接收方,而是被存放到一个容器中,当满足一定的条件之后,消息会被容器发送给接收方,这个容器即消息队列(MQ),而完成这个功能需要双方和容器以及其中的各个组件遵守统一的约定和规则,AMQP就是这样的一种协议,消息发送与接受的双方遵守这个协议可以实现异步通讯。
1、RabbitMQ管理控制台的使用(1)添加allinpay 用户(2)添加虚拟机 /jinqiao2、使用简单模式完成消息传递3、RabbitMQ的工作模式3.1 Work queues 工作队列模式在一个队列中,如果有多个消费者,都监听同一个队列,那么消费者之间对于同一个消息的关系是竞争的关系。例如:短信服务部署多个,只需要有一个节点成功发送即可。生产:  消费者1和消
# 在 Spring Boot 中实现 RocketMQ 消费者的教程 在微服务架构中,消息队列常用于异步处理和解耦。在这里,我将指导您如何在 Spring Boot 应用程序中实现 RocketMQ 消费者。以下是实现的整体流程。 ## 实现步骤 | 步骤 | 描述 | |------|--------------
原创 10月前
155阅读
  • 1
  • 2
  • 3
  • 4
  • 5